A search is under way for a man believed to have arrived in Western Australia by boat with a group of people on Friday.

The man was thought to have become separated from the group near Mitchell Plateau, in the far northern reaches of the remote Kimberley region.

WA police said they were advised on Saturday the man may have been a passenger on an “unknown vessel”.

Police said the land search operation was in its preliminary stages and was taking place in an extremely remote area with challenging terrain.

Last month, Rohingya refugees were rescued as their boat capsized off West Aceh, Indonesia, on their way to Australia.

The Australian has reported the group, understood to be 15 people, were Chinese nationals that had arrived at the remote Mungalalu Truscott Airbase.

Two groups of more than 40 asylum seekers from Bangladesh and Pakistan were found north of Broome in February after they arrived in WA by boat.

They were flown to an offshore detention centre on the Pacific island of Nauru.

In November, 12 people who landed a boat in another remote section of coastline in the Kimberley were taken to the government’s offshore detention centre in Nauru.
